Mr. Brown, 91, of Bogue Chitto, MS passed from this life on October 25, 2024. He was born on December 21, 1932 in Natchez, Mississippi. He loved the Lord and  prayed for his family and extended family every day; he was a faithful member of Johnston Station Baptist Church where he served as a deacon, worked to establish the church cemetery, and faithfully and gladly supported missions. Until the end of his life he took every opportunity to witness to others about Jesus Christ.
As a boy, Mr. Earl learned to work on the farm with his father – picking cotton, growing sweet potatoes, and milking cows by hand; he was very active in 4-H as a young man and continued to help his father in farming beef cattle. A hard worker, Mr. Earl operated a dairy farm for 53 years with the help of his children; he also had a gravel business and worked at some other supportive occupations. He was a devoted son and a loving husband and father.
